#include "api.hpp"
#include "library/debug.hpp"
#include <exception>
#include <stdexcept>
extern "C" void
omnitrace_push_trace(const char* _name)
{
omnitrace_push_trace_hidden(_name);
}
extern "C" void
omnitrace_pop_trace(const char* _name)
{
omnitrace_pop_trace_hidden(_name);
}
extern "C" int
omnitrace_push_region(const char* _name)
{
try
{
omnitrace_push_region_hidden(_name);
} catch(std::exception& _e)
{
OMNITRACE_VERBOSE_F(1, "Exception caught: %s\n", _e.what());
return -1;
}
return 0;
}
extern "C" int
omnitrace_pop_region(const char* _name)
{
try
{
omnitrace_pop_region_hidden(_name);
} catch(std::exception& _e)
{
OMNITRACE_VERBOSE_F(1, "Exception caught: %s\n", _e.what());
return -1;
}
return 0;
}
extern "C" int
omnitrace_push_category_region(omnitrace_category_t _category, const char* _name,
omnitrace_annotation_t* _annotations,
size_t _annotation_count)
{
try
{
omnitrace_push_category_region_hidden(_category, _name, _annotations,
_annotation_count);
} catch(std::exception& _e)
{
OMNITRACE_VERBOSE_F(1, "Exception caught: %s\n", _e.what());
return -1;
}
return 0;
}
extern "C" int
omnitrace_pop_category_region(omnitrace_category_t _category, const char* _name,
omnitrace_annotation_t* _annotations,
size_t _annotation_count)
{
try
{
omnitrace_pop_category_region_hidden(_category, _name, _annotations,
_annotation_count);
} catch(std::exception& _e)
{
OMNITRACE_VERBOSE_F(1, "Exception caught: %s\n", _e.what());
return -1;
}
return 0;
}
extern "C" void
omnitrace_init_library(void)
{
omnitrace_init_library_hidden();
}
extern "C" void
omnitrace_init_tooling(void)
{
omnitrace_init_tooling_hidden();
}
extern "C" void
omnitrace_init(const char* _mode, bool _rewrite, const char* _arg0)
{
omnitrace_init_hidden(_mode, _rewrite, _arg0);
}
extern "C" void
omnitrace_finalize(void)
{
omnitrace_finalize_hidden();
}
extern "C" void
omnitrace_reset_preload(void)
{
omnitrace_reset_preload_hidden();
}
extern "C" void
omnitrace_set_env(const char* env_name, const char* env_val)
{
omnitrace_set_env_hidden(env_name, env_val);
}
extern "C" void
omnitrace_set_mpi(bool use, bool attached)
{
omnitrace_set_mpi_hidden(use, attached);
}
extern "C" void
omnitrace_register_source(const char* file, const char* func, size_t line, size_t address,
const char* source)
{
omnitrace_register_source_hidden(file, func, line, address, source);
}
extern "C" void
omnitrace_register_coverage(const char* file, const char* func, size_t address)
{
omnitrace_register_coverage_hidden(file, func, address);
}
